Here are 10 new non-stop destinations from Montreal and Quebec City to consider for your summer getaway:
1) Catania, Sicily (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

Dreaming of an island where life slows down and every moment feels intentional? Take advantage of this new non-stop flight from Montreal to Sicily, where breathtaking landscapes meet thousand-year-old historical sites. Get ready for a destination where food is truly a celebration of the senses.
Home to some of the most beautiful beaches in Europe, you will get to bathe in the turquoise waters of the Mediterranean.is.
You could spend your morning wandering UNESCO-listed cobblestone streets, and your evening enjoying fresh seafood pasta with a glass of award-winning local wine. Sicily isn’t just a destination, it’s a vibe, where your only concern is to follow the rhythm of thce vita.
This brand-new direct flight from Montreal to Catania, operated by Air Canada from June 4 to October 22, 2026, runs three times per week (Tuesdays, Thursdays, and Saturdays). Flight time is approximately 8 hours and 30 minutes.
2) Palma de Mallorca, Spain (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

If you haven’t experienced Mallorca yet, it’s the largest of the Balearic Islands, and it offers a unique balance that will appeal to any traveller. Away from the party scene of Ibiza and less rugged than some Greek islands, Palma blends elegance, simplicity, sophistication, and spectacular nature. The narrow streets of its old town will charm you with a majestic cathedral and lively cafés.
Rent a car to drive along the Serra de Tramuntana where you will discover secluded beaches.End your day the Spanish way with tapas and chilled white wine. Mallorca offers that easy, sun-soaked, balanced vacation vibe.
Air Canada now flies direct from Montreal to Palma from June 17 to October 21, 2026, four times per week (Mondays, Wednesdays, Fridays, and Sundays). Flight time is about 8 hours.
3) Dakar, Senegal (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

Looking for a truly unique vacation destination? Head to Africa with this new non-stop route from Montreal to Dakar.
Dive straight into the warmth of Senegal as you explore Gorée Island, join wildlife safaris, stroll through lively markets and relax on coastal beaches. The hospitality is so deeply rooted that there’s even a word for it, “teranga”, used specifically to describe the exceptional warmth of Senegalese culture.
Expect unforgettable discoveries, such as lagoons and a pink lake to natural reserves where you might spot rhinos and giraffes. And of course, your African adventure wouldn’t be complete without flavourful, aromatic jollof rice.
Air Transat operates this direct Montreal–Dakar route from June 17 to October 21, 2026, twice per week (Wednesdays and Saturdays). Flight time is approximately 7 hours and 30 minutes.
4) Reykjavik, Iceland (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

This summer, seize the opportunity to fly non-stop from Montreal to Iceland, a destination that truly lives up to the hype.
Nestled at the edge of the world, this small country of striking purity transports you into dramatic landscapes shaped by volcanoes, geysers, glaciers, and green valleys.
Do not miss out on the famous thermal spas. You can relax in natural geothermal pools, where you can soak outdoors surrounded by lava fields and cool air for an unforgettable experience.
The water in Iceland is so pure that you can drink it straight from the tap, and homes are heated using geothermal energy.
An added bonus? No mosquitoes. No predators. Explore, hike, or set out on a road trip through breathtaking scenery in remarkable peace and quiet.
Air Transat flies direct from Montreal to Reykjavik from June 16 to September 27, 2026, on Tuesdays and Sundays. The flight is just 5 hours and 30 minutes for a total change of scenery.
5) Rio de Janeiro, Brazil (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

If you’re craving true exotic energy, get ready for Brazil’s heat and vibrancy. This new flight takes you straight from Montreal to Rio in about 10 hours.
Caipirinhas on the beach. Endless sunshine. Joyful, contagious energy. Between Copacabana and Ipanema, let yourself be swept up by the ocean and the electric atmosphere.
Air Transat offers one weekly non-stop flight from Montreal to Rio between February 4 and June 10, 2026. It might be the perfect time to plan your Brazilian escape.

6) Agadir, Morocco (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

From the moment you land in Agadir, get ready for a true change of scenery. Let the fragrant tagines, long breakfasts made with fresh local ingredients, and warm Moroccan hospitality set the tone for your stay.
You’ll be charmed by the welcoming atmosphere and captivated by scenery that feels straight out of One Thousand and One Nights. On the agenda in this seaside destination: beach time, of course! But make sure to also visit the kasbah overlooking the city, and browse through colourful souks.
Air Transat launches this new non-stop route from Montreal to Agadir starting June 12, 2026, with one direct flight per week. In just about seven hours, you’ll find yourself in North Africa.
7) Guadalajara, Mexico (New non-stop flight from Montreal)

You might already know beachside Mexico, but have you experienced cultural Mexico? Guadalajara is the birthplace of mariachi and tequila. Beyond the imposing colonial architecture, you will discover a vibrant arts scene and get to visit traditional distilleries. It’s an enriching and surprising alternative for summer travel.
Air Canada launches direct flights from Montreal to Guadalajara starting June 2, 2026, three times per week (Tuesdays, Thursdays, and Saturdays). Flight time is about 5 hours and 30 minutes.
8) Marseille, France (New non-stop flight from Quebec City)

Imagine if you could enjoy the Mediterranean sunshine without connecting through Montreal? Marseille is now accessible directly from Quebec City.
No need to fly all the way to Italy or Greece, the South of France is calling. With nearly 300 days of sunshine per year, it’s hard to beat.
Life slows down here. Embrace the Provençal rhythm by savouring delicious meals or lingering over coffee. Don’t miss the turquoise Calanques and the bustling local markets.
Air Transat flies Quebec City–Marseille from May 21 to October 8, 2026, on Thursdays. Flight time is about 7 hours and 30 minutes.
9) Nantes, France (New non-stop flight from Quebec City)

Majestic castles to explore? Check. Sipping wine in picturesque vineyards? Check. Getting lost in little charming villages that make you want to stay forever? Check! You can now reach it all with a non-stop flight from Quebec City to Nantes.
Spend your vacation exploring this elegant and underrated French city, enjoying aperitifs on a terrace, and driving through the Loire Valley at your own pace.
Air Transat operates the direct Quebec City–Nantes route from June 2 to October 20, 2026, on Tuesdays. Flight time is approximately 7 hours.
10) Fort-de-France, Martinique (New non-stop flight from Quebec City)

If volcanic hikes and paradise beaches are on your wish list, Martinique should be your next tropical getaway.
This Caribbean island stands out for its accessible nature, since all hiking trails are free, even those maintained by the National Forestry Office. A major bonus.
Air Canada maintains year-round service (launched December 2025), with one weekly Monday flight from Quebec City to Fort-de-France. Just 4 hours and 30 minutes separate you from the Caribbean.
